SLC 5 (Enhanced) binary, integer, float,
ASCII, and string files
Fnnn:www/bb
F File type:
B = Binary
N = Integer
F = Floating Point
A = ASCII
ST = String
nnn
(optional) File number:
Binary: 3, 9 – 255 decimal
Integer: 7, 9 – 255 decimal
Floating Point: 8, 9 – 255 decimal
ASCII: 9 – 255 decimal
String: 9 – 255 decimal
For direct driver communication, binary, integer,
and floating point file types use the default file
number if the file number is absent. The default
numbers are 3 (binary), 7 (integer), and
8 (floating point).
www Word address: 0 – 255 decimal
bb
(optional) Bit offset within word: 0 – 15 decimal
Bit offset is not supported for floating point and
string file types.
Example: F8:129
